Immunic appoints biopharmaceutical executive Jon Congleton to board

Immunic Inc (NASDAQ:IMUX, FRA:10VA) has announced the appointment of veteran biopharmaceutical executive Jon Congleton to its board of directors, as the company advances its multiple sclerosis program through late-stage development.

Congleton brings nearly four decades of experience in the biopharmaceutical industry, with a background spanning drug development, commercialization, and executive leadership, according to Immunic.

His work has covered multiple therapeutic areas, including cardiovascular, gastrointestinal, and central nervous system (CNS) conditions.

During his career, Congleton was involved in the US launch of Copaxone, a treatment for relapsing forms of multiple sclerosis (MS) developed by Teva Pharmaceuticals Industries. He later led US operations for the product as it became one of the most widely prescribed MS therapies.

Congleton currently serves as chief executive officer of Mineralys Therapeutics, where he has overseen the company’s transition from a private-stage firm to a publicly traded biotechnology company.

His previous leadership roles include serving as CEO of Impel NeuroPharma and Nivalis Therapeutics. Earlier in his career, he held senior positions at Teva, including leadership of its North American neuroscience business and global CNS franchise.

“Jon's deep CNS expertise and proven track record in late-stage drug development and commercialization will be invaluable as we advance vidofludimus calcium through its pivotal clinical milestones and toward potential regulatory approval and commercial launch," said Simona Skerjanec, interim chairperson of Immunic’s board of directors.

"I am thrilled that Jon is joining us at this critical moment as we evolve our Board to support Immunic in its transition into a fully integrated commercial-stage company."

Congleton described vidofludimus calcium as a “potentially transformative opportunity” for MS patients, noting its advantages over currently available therapies.

“I look forward to working with the Board and the leadership team and contributing my experience to support Immunic as it advances toward the pivotal trial readouts later this year and long-term value creation,” Congleton said.

Shares of Immunic were up around 5.3% on Tuesday morning.
